About prior approval applications
How this application type works
Prior approval applications arise where permitted development rights already grant the principle of the work, such as larger home extensions, changes of use to housing or agricultural buildings. The council may only consider the specific matters set out in the rules, for example transport, flooding or appearance, and in many classes the work may proceed if the council does not respond within the deadline, commonly 56 days.
